Lakes Recycling Initiatives

NexTrex Plastic Recycling 

The program has been revamped and our goal is now to collect 250lbs of plastic EACH quarter. 

  • Produce bags, grocery bags, ice bags, cereal box liners, bread bags, bubble wrap, dry cleaning bags - Plastics that can stretch. 
  • BIG NEWS! We have reached our goal and collected over 250lbs. We'll start collecting another 250lbs for our next goal!

Papergator Recycling

Papergator use can continue throughout the summer! The green dumpster is located in the side parking lot. Papergator can accept office/school papers, newspapers, junk mail, magazines, shredded paper, and cereal boxes (paperboard that can be torn), etc. Please note, wrapping paper (without sparkles) can be donated to Papergator for all your Holiday party cleanup!

Pop Can Tabs

Pop can tabs are collected in the office and sent to the Ronald McDonald House. Please bring to Mrs. Low in the office.
